EMITT, one of the 5 largest tourism fairs in the world, opened its doors in Istanbul. Istanbul Governor Davut Gül, Union of Municipalities of Türkiye and Istanbul Metropolitan Municipality Mayor Ekrem İmamoğlu and Eskişehir Metropolitan Municipality Mayor Ayşe Ünlüce attended the opening.
After the opening ceremony, Mayor Ünlüce toured the fairground and then attended the panel “Brave Steps for Tourism: Municipalities Initiating Transformation” panel as a speaker. The panel was moderated by Dr. Şengül Altan Arslan, Deputy Secretary General of the Union of Municipalities of Türkiye, and in addition to Mayor Ünlüce, Ahmet Öküzcüoğlu, Mayor of Alaşehir, Manisa and Şükrü Sargın, Mayor of Zile, Tokat took part as speakers.
Mayor Ünlüce said that they are realizing many projects to promote Eskişehir’s tourism potential to Türkiye and the World. “We are creating a 'tourism portal' in our city by keeping up with the digitalization required by our age. This portal will work in integration with our smart urbanization applications. Thanks to the free wifi points of our city, our tourists will have easy access to the portal. Local and foreign tourists will see the tourism potential of Eskişehir with the mobile application they download to their mobile phones. We are currently creating all the data of our application. With this innovative application, we will make Eskişehir a more accessible city. When you come to our city as a tourist, the portal will create a route for you according to how many days or how many hours you will stay. It will include taste stops, gastronomy destinations, museums, historical sites and will guide you according to the time you want to spend. We will label our local businesses so that our local tradesmen can also benefit from this mobility. Our tourists will be able to find the answer to how to get there by tram, bus or bicycle thanks to the application showing the transportation routes. The portal will include foreign language options.”
Stating that local governments have the most important share in the development of tourism, Mayor Ünlüce said that the transformation in Eskişehir started with the former Mayor Prof. Dr. Yılmaz Büyükerşen. Stating that an important step was taken for the development of tourism in Eskişehir after the rehabilitation works carried out in Porsuk Stream, Mayor Ünlüce said, “Our Eskişehir really shines like a star in the middle of the steppe. As Eskişehir Metropolitan Municipality, we have done many works one after the other. The whole city was mobilized and everyone took part in that beautiful transformation. Of course, bureaucratic obstacles are a part of the life of municipalities, but if you are really determined, there is nothing you cannot accomplish; Eskişehir is one example. The museums we opened, the City Theaters and the establishment of the Symphony Orchestra have made our city a preferred city in terms of culture and arts. I would also like to mention that we are the only municipality in Türkiye that has a Symphony Orchestra. Thanks to all these developments, we host tourists in our city not only in certain periods but for 12 months. Our neighboring provinces are always fed by the culture and art activities and tourism in Eskişehir. During the weekend, Eskişehir hosts almost twice as many citizens as its population.
